Understanding Nozzle Specifications in IPX9K Testing

Table of Contents

The nozzle is the heart of the IPX9K test setup, directly influencing water flow, pressure, and spray patterns. According to IEC 60529, nozzles must adhere to precise dimensions outlined in Figures 7 through 9 to replicate real-world high-pressure scenarios accurately.

Nozzle Dimension Comparison Table

Dimension Feature Standard Value Tolerance Why It Matters
Orifice Diameter ~2.5-3 mm (typical) ±0.01 mm Controls flow rate and pressure drop
Overall Length ~13.33 mm ±0.04 mm Ensures consistent jet formation
Radius (e.g., R0.75) 0.75 mm ±0.01 mm Affects spray pattern uniformity
Surface Finish Polished Stainless Steel No burrs Prevents clogging and uneven distribution
  • Spray Parameters: Tests require angles at 0°, 30°, 60°, and 90° with a flow rate of 14-16 liters per minute and pressure between 8-10 MPa (80-100 bar). Any deviation, such as using oversized nozzles, can skew results by altering impact force.

Failing to calibrate nozzles through third-party verification is a frequent error, often driven by budget constraints. This not only invalidates the test but also risks product failures in harsh environments like vehicle undercarriages or outdoor electronics.

Mastering Water Temperature Control for Reliable Results

Water temperature is another cornerstone of IPX9K testing, simulating hot, humid conditions that products might encounter. The IEC 60529 standard mandates a range of 80 ± 5°C, with unwavering stability throughout the process.

Why Temperature Matters:

  • High temperatures test material resilience against thermal expansion and water ingress under pressure. Inconsistent heating can mask vulnerabilities, leading to false positives in durability assessments.
  • Best Practices:

  • Implement PID controllers and circulation systems to maintain steady temperatures.

    Common Industry Pitfalls and Solutions Table

    Common Mistake Cause Consequence Recommended Solution
    Incorrect Nozzle Size Cost-cutting or uncalibrated parts Altered spray dynamics, invalid results Use certified nozzles with verification
    Temperature Fluctuations Poor insulation or unstable supply Hidden weaknesses in seals/materials PID control + preheating circulation
    Incomplete Angle Coverage Manual errors or faulty automation Uneven testing Automated turntable at 5 rpm
    Skipping Calibration Time/budget constraints Non-compliance with IEC 60529 Annual third-party calibration

    These shortcuts violate standards like ISO 20653, compromising test integrity and endangering users.
